Document Description
The California Department of Fish and Wildlife (CDFW) has executed Lake and Streambed Alteration Agreement No. EPIMS-SON-19092-R3, pursuant to Fish and Game Code section 1602, to the project Applicant, Stony Point Flats Limited Partnership. The project is limited to filling three unnamed tributaries to Roseland Creek as part of the development of a 50-unit affordable apartment community that will be setback at least 65 feet from Roseland Creek. Stormwater flows will be directed to the southwest through a new onsite stormwater drainage system to the existing public storm drain system in Stony Point Road, which discharges into Roseland Creek. The stormwater from the development site will be directed to on-site vegetated bioretention beds that will be strategically located throughout the site to meet the City of Santa Rosa’s South West Low Impact Development requirements. The project will result in permanent impacts to approximately 3,180 square feet (0.073 acres) and 782 linear feet of stream and riparian habitat. No riparian trees will be removed.

Other Location Info
The project is located at three unnamed tributaries to Roseland Creek in the City of Santa Rosa, County of Sonoma, State of California, at 2268 Stony Point Road.
